Special Weather Statement issued August 16 at 11:27PM CDT by NWS North Platte NE
Details
At 1127 PM CDT, Doppler radar was tracking a strong thunderstorm 21
miles southeast of Gordon, moving southeast at 25 mph.
HAZARD…Wind gusts of 50 to 55 mph and pea size hail.
SOURCE…Radar indicated.
IMPACT…Gusty winds could knock down tree limbs and blow around
unsecured objects. Minor hail damage to vegetation is
possible.
Locations impacted include…
Highway 61 crossing the Snake River.
This includes Highway 61 between mile markers 185 and 206.
Instructions
If outdoors, consider seeking shelter inside a building.
